Lilac Cottage, located on Bradcar Road in Shropham, Attleborough, is a detached house built before 1900. The property has a floor area of 186 square meters and is fully double glazed. Its energy rating is 'C' and its current CO2 emission is 6.0. The property has undergone some energy-saving measures, with a potential energy-saving of £1374.00. The house has 9 heated rooms, a pitched roof with 250mm loft insulation, and is heated by a boiler and radiators using oil. The current running costs are £1597.00.
